About Jack Preiss

Jack Preiss is a scholar working on Molecular Biology, Nutrition and Dietetics, Plant Science, Biotechnology and Materials Chemistry, having authored 240 papers that have together received 14.1k indexed citations. Recurring topics across this work include Enzyme Production and Characterization (66 papers), Microbial Metabolites in Food Biotechnology (55 papers), Enzyme Structure and Function (51 papers), Food composition and properties (39 papers), Plant nutrient uptake and metabolism (34 papers), Carbohydrate Chemistry and Synthesis (32 papers), Biochemical and Molecular Research (32 papers) and Glycosylation and Glycoproteins Research (31 papers). The work is most often cited by research in Biotechnology (3.3k citations), Nutrition and Dietetics (4.7k citations), Plant Science (5.9k citations), Biochemistry (760 citations) and Geriatrics and Gerontology (276 citations). Jack Preiss has collaborated with scholars based in United States, Argentina and Spain. Frequent co-authors include Philip Handler, Miguel A. Ballícora, Elaine Greenberg, Charles D. Boyer, Alberto Á. Iglesias, Anselm Strauss, Leonard Schatzman, Gilbert Ashwell, Hara P. Ghosh and Tsan‐Piao Lin. Their work appears in journals such as Archives of Biochemistry and Biophysics, PLANT PHYSIOLOGY, Journal of Biological Chemistry, Biochemical and Biophysical Research Communications and Biochemistry.
